Franklin County Times - Russellville, Alabama, April 29, 1937, Thu, Pg 1
Pickney Borden Killed In Fall From Crusher At Woodward Mines
Pickney Richard Borden, age 44, of route 8, Russellville, was instantly killed when he fell from a crusher at Woodward mines, five miles west of Russellville, at 3:40 P.M. last Monday.
Funeral services were held Wednesday morning from King's cemetery, with Rev. Daily conducting final rites, Underwood's directing at the grave.
Surviving, in addition to his widow, are his mother, Mrs. Sarah Borden; three sons, Evil, J. D., and Monroe, and three daughters, Nancy, Fannie and Lillian.
